Summary
Astrion is seeking a Launch Acquisition Analyst in Kirtland AFB to support the USSF Space Systems Command Rocket Systems Launch Program. You will engage in acquisition planning, source selections, and documentation development for orbital and suborbital launch service procurements.The role requires collaboration with government acquisition professionals, engineers, and mission stakeholders to optimize acquisition execution and ensure compliant, timely procurement activities.#J-18808-Ljbffr
